Class: TencentCloud::Af::V20200226::QueryAntiFraudRequest
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Af::V20200226::QueryAntiFraudRequest
- Defined in:
- lib/v20200226/models.rb
Overview
QueryAntiFraud请求参数结构体
Instance Attribute Summary collapse
-
#AccountType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Address 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#AppIdU 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#BankCardNumber 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#BusinessId 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#EmailAddress 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#IdCryptoType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Idfa 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#IdNumber 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Imei 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Imsi 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Mac 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Name 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#NameCryptoType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#PhoneCryptoType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#PhoneNumber 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Scene 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#Uid 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#UserIp 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#WifiBSSID 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#WifiMac 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
-
#WifiSSID 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5.
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(phonenumber = nil, idnumber = nil, bankcardnumber = nil, userip = nil, imei = nil, idfa = nil, scene = nil, name = nil, emailaddress = nil, address = nil, mac = nil, imsi = nil, accounttype = nil, uid = nil, appidu = nil, wifimac = nil, wifissid = nil, wifibssid = nil, businessid = nil, idcryptotype = nil, phonecryptotype = nil, namecryptotype = nil) ⇒ QueryAntiFraudRequest
constructor
A new instance of QueryAntiFraudRequest.
Constructor Details
#initialize(phonenumber = nil, idnumber = nil, bankcardnumber = nil, userip = nil, imei = nil, idfa = nil, scene = nil, name = nil, emailaddress = nil, address = nil, mac = nil, imsi = nil, accounttype = nil, uid = nil, appidu = nil, wifimac = nil, wifissid = nil, wifibssid = nil, businessid = nil, idcryptotype = nil, phonecryptotype = nil, namecryptotype = nil) ⇒ QueryAntiFraudRequest
Returns a new instance of QueryAntiFraudRequest.
680 681 682 683 684 685 686 687 688 689 690 691 692 693 694 695 696 697 698 699 700 701 702 703 |
# File 'lib/v20200226/models.rb', line 680 def initialize(phonenumber=nil, idnumber=nil, bankcardnumber=nil, userip=nil, imei=nil, idfa=nil, scene=nil, name=nil, emailaddress=nil, address=nil, mac=nil, imsi=nil, accounttype=nil, uid=nil, appidu=nil, wifimac=nil, wifissid=nil, wifibssid=nil, businessid=nil, idcryptotype=nil, phonecryptotype=nil, namecryptotype=nil) @PhoneNumber = phonenumber @IdNumber = idnumber @BankCardNumber = bankcardnumber @UserIp = userip @Imei = imei @Idfa = idfa @Scene = scene @Name = name @EmailAddress = emailaddress @Address = address @Mac = mac @Imsi = imsi @AccountType = accounttype @Uid = uid @AppIdU = appidu @WifiMac = wifimac @WifiSSID = wifissid @WifiBSSID = wifibssid @BusinessId = businessid @IdCryptoType = idcryptotype @PhoneCryptoType = phonecryptotype @NameCryptoType = namecryptotype end |
Instance Attribute Details
#AccountType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def AccountType @AccountType end |
#Address 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Address @Address end |
#AppIdU 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def AppIdU @AppIdU end |
#BankCardNumber 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def BankCardNumber @BankCardNumber end |
#BusinessId 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def BusinessId @BusinessId end |
#EmailAddress 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def EmailAddress @EmailAddress end |
#IdCryptoType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def IdCryptoType @IdCryptoType end |
#Idfa 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Idfa @Idfa end |
#IdNumber 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def IdNumber @IdNumber end |
#Imei 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Imei @Imei end |
#Imsi 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Imsi @Imsi end |
#Mac 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Mac @Mac end |
#Name 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Name @Name end |
#NameCryptoType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def NameCryptoType @NameCryptoType end |
#PhoneCryptoType 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def PhoneCryptoType @PhoneCryptoType end |
#PhoneNumber 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def PhoneNumber @PhoneNumber end |
#Scene 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Scene @Scene end |
#Uid 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def Uid @Uid end |
#UserIp 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def UserIp @UserIp end |
#WifiBSSID 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def WifiBSSID @WifiBSSID end |
#WifiMac 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def WifiMac @WifiMac end |
#WifiSSID ⇒ Object
开放帐号微信: 2; 唯一标识网站或应用 ID 区分统计数据 0:不加密(默认值) 1:md5 2:sha256 3:SM3 0:不加密(默认值) 1:md5, 2:sha256 3:SM3 0:不加密(默认值) 1:md5
678 679 680 |
# File 'lib/v20200226/models.rb', line 678 def WifiSSID @WifiSSID end |
Instance Method Details
#deserialize(params) ⇒ Object
705 706 707 708 709 710 711 712 713 714 715 716 717 718 719 720 721 722 723 724 725 726 727 728 |
# File 'lib/v20200226/models.rb', line 705 def deserialize(params) @PhoneNumber = params['PhoneNumber'] @IdNumber = params['IdNumber'] @BankCardNumber = params['BankCardNumber'] @UserIp = params['UserIp'] @Imei = params['Imei'] @Idfa = params['Idfa'] @Scene = params['Scene'] @Name = params['Name'] @EmailAddress = params['EmailAddress'] @Address = params['Address'] @Mac = params['Mac'] @Imsi = params['Imsi'] @AccountType = params['AccountType'] @Uid = params['Uid'] @AppIdU = params['AppIdU'] @WifiMac = params['WifiMac'] @WifiSSID = params['WifiSSID'] @WifiBSSID = params['WifiBSSID'] @BusinessId = params['BusinessId'] @IdCryptoType = params['IdCryptoType'] @PhoneCryptoType = params['PhoneCryptoType'] @NameCryptoType = params['NameCryptoType'] end |